IMPACT – MEDIUM
What is the change? UAE immigration offices will be closed for a four-day weekend, Nov. 30-Dec. 3, as the country observes UAE National Day.
What does the change mean? Offices will reopen Dec. 4. Applicants should account for the closure and expect delays.
Background: UAE National Day is a national holiday celebrated on Dec. 2 to commemorate the federal unification of the seven emirates. In observance of the holiday, nationwide celebrations and government office closures are planned.
Analysis & Comments: In addition to the immigration office closures, applicants should check holiday observances for embassies and consulates, as they may vary depending on location. Employers should anticipate delays and submit applications before the holidays if possible.
